34 FLIGHT. ADVERTISEMENTS. MAY II, 1939. Situations Vacant—Contd. R OYAL AIE FORCE. "y-ACANCIES For Air Observers. CANDIDATES are Required in Large Numbers for Training and Service in the Royal Air Force as Air Observers; they will be required (or the interesting and responsible duties of navigators of aircraft; no previous flying ex perience is necessary. A GE 17i to 28 Years. THEY Must be Educated to the Standard of the School Certificate, particularly in mathematics; unmarried; good physique. ON Satisfactory Completion of Training (about five months) Air Observers will be given the rank of sergeant with pay at 9/- a day; after a probationary period (normally six months) pay is increased to 12/6 a day; (food, accommodation, etc., are provided free). APPOINTMENTS are For Four Years, Followed by Six Years' Reserve Service; a proportion of those suitable will be selected for training as airman pilots or for advance ment to commissioned rank. • G RATTITY of £75 Payable. A PPLY (by post card) to Air Ministry (Deft. -iX S.7.) (C.J.), London. Situations Vacant—Contd. R OYAL AIR FORCE. "YTACANCIES for Equipment Officers. CANDIDATES are Invited to Apply for a Limited Number of Short Service Commis sions for Equipment Duties in the Royal Air Force; they must have attained their 20th but not attained their 25th birthday, and no exten sion to these age limits can be allowed. THEY Must Have Been Educated to the Standard of the School Leaving Certificate, and have had suitable business experience, un married, good physique. APPOINTMENTS Are for Four Years, when Gratuity of £300 is payable, followed by six years' Reserve service. APPLY (by postcard) to Under-Secretary of State, Air Ministry (Dept.
